How do the directions to make a protein get from the nucleus to the cytoplasm?

Respuesta :

hworonie hworonie
  • 02-03-2016
The mRNA made from the section of DNA coding for the protein (the gene) exits the nucleus through a nuclear pore after getting modified. It can get modified by getting a poly-A tail and a methylated cap, along with removing the interfering sequences (introns).
